Elaine was born in Chehalis, WA, Aug 15, 1946 to Bill and Thora Charneski. She passed away June 10, 2018 due to a massive heart attack and did not suffer.
She is survived by her only child, a daughter Susan Nichols.
She was preceded in death by her parents William Harrison Charneski, Thora Marie Charneski and brother William Charneski Jr.
Elaine lived in Pe Ell, WA until about 8 or 9 yrs. of age, and then moved with her family to Raymond, WA; where she was raised. She graduated from Raymond High School in 1966.
She was married to Dale Nichols (now deceased). They divorced when Susie was about 2 yrs. She then was married a 2nd time briefly, and then married Robert Presnell (now deceased) in the 1970's.
She lived most of her life in Washington, although she lived in Alaska and Oklahoma for a short time. Washington was her favorite place to live.
Elaine had many jobs in her life from working in the seafood canneries, waitressing, packing fruit in Eastern Washington, driving semi, worked for an airline, and she also sold Watkin Products for many years. Her highlight was graduating Nursing School on her 52nd birthday. She worked in nursing homes and especially loved working with the Alzheimer patients. She was also active in the VFW Ladies Auxiliary years ago, always helping anyone she could in many ways.
After retirement she enjoyed her friends, playing bingo and going to the casino. She loved to cook, especially for her family friends. She loved taking road trips with her daughter. She was an avid reader and loved to crochet, she was passionate about crocheting hats and scarfs for the homeless and cancer patients, and she even sent them as far as England. She loved coloring in the adult coloring books she must have had over 30 books she was working on. She also worked with ceramics for a time.
She recently gave her heart to the Lord and was enjoying going to church and getting to know the people. She said "We are going to church because if I want to go to heaven I have to start somewhere"
She was very witty and fun loving lady and left an impression on everyone she met. Her soul was kind and she will live in our hearts forever.
